Kensington Park in Lawrenceville, GA is a quiet, walkable neighborhood that draws families and professionals who want the convenience of city access with the comfort of a strong suburban community. Located in Gwinnett County, this pocket of Lawrenceville offers an inviting streetscape, mature trees, and a blend of traditional and contemporary homes that make it easy to imagine putting down roots. Whether you are searching for homes for sale in Kensington Park Lawrenceville or just exploring Gwinnett County neighborhoods, this community stands out for its accessibility and everyday livability.

Homes in Kensington Park typically feature practical floor plans with three to five bedrooms, generous yards, and architectural details that range from Craftsman touches to newer transitional builds. Sidewalks and street lights line most streets, creating a safe environment for evening strolls, morning jogs, and neighborhood get-togethers. Many homes are within easy walking distance to local shopping and schools, meaning simple errands and the school run can often be done without a long drive.

Education is a major draw for families relocating to Kensington Park. The neighborhood is served by High School Central, Middle School Moore, and Elementary School Holt. These schools are part of the Gwinnett County Public Schools network and are respected by area parents for their academic programs, extracurricular activities, and community involvement. Living within walking distance to school adds a layer of convenience that busy families greatly appreciate.

Beyond classrooms, Kensington Park benefits from Lawrenceville's broader amenities. Historic downtown Lawrenceville is only a short drive away and offers boutique shops, local restaurants, a growing arts scene, and seasonal community events. Nearby parks and green spaces provide spots for weekend picnics, youth sports, and nature walks. For everyday needs, retail centers and grocery options are within easy reach, making daily life comfortable for residents who value both convenience and a relaxed pace.

Commuting from Kensington Park is straightforward. Major routes such as I-85 and regional connectors provide direct access to Midtown and Downtown Atlanta, making this neighborhood attractive to commuters who want a suburban lifestyle without sacrificing city accessibility. Gwinnett County transit options and nearby employment hubs also support professionals who work throughout the metro area. Proximity to medical facilities and business centers in Lawrenceville and surrounding communities adds to the neighborhood's appeal.
